Contents

6 rzeczy, które możesz zrobić z interpreterem kodu ChatGPT

Interpreter kodów ChatGPT€™ jest zdecydowanie najpotężniejszą funkcją dostępną na platformie ChatGPT. Chociaż wielu nie zdaje sobie z tego sprawy, to narzędzie ma wiele ekscytujących zastosowań i może zrobić znacznie więcej niż kilka zadań, do których jest obecnie używane.

Z pewnością! Wtyczka ChatGPT Code Interpreter oferuje użytkownikom wiele możliwości wykorzystania jej funkcjonalności. W tej sekcji przedstawimy kilka praktycznych zastosowań, z których można skorzystać natychmiast po instalacji.

Twórz i edytuj obrazy

Korzystanie z interpretera kodu ChatGPT umożliwia wykonywanie różnych urzekających manipulacji obrazami bez konieczności posiadania zaawansowanej biegłości technicznej. Wystarczy tylko przekazać pożądany rezultat w języku potocznym, co zaowocuje rezultatami i alternatywami, którym może brakować finezji profesjonalnego oprogramowania do edycji zdjęć, takiego jak Adobe Photoshop, a mimo to dawać intrygujące i satysfakcjonujące rezultaty.

Rzeczywiście istnieje wiele urzekających operacji, które można wykonać na obrazach cyfrowych. Na przykład przekształcenie obrazu w monochromatyczną paletę poprzez konwersję do skali szarości jest popularnym wyborem dla osób poszukujących prostoty i elegancji. Podobnie podzielenie obrazu na cztery równe sekcje lub ćwiartki pozwala na łatwą organizację i analizę jego części składowych. I odwrotnie, odwrócenie schematu kolorów obrazu poprzez odwrócenie kolorów tworzy uderzający wizualnie efekt, który można kreatywnie wykorzystać w różnych zastosowaniach. Ogólnie rzecz biorąc, badanie tych i innych technik obrazowania może prowadzić do ekscytujących odkryć i innowacyjnych zastosowań fotografii cyfrowej.

Prześlij obraz do interfejsu Code Interpreter i podaj opis żądanej akcji, używając codziennego języka. Na przykład możesz eksperymentować z różnymi podpowiedziami, aby osiągnąć intrygujące rezultaty.

Proszę wyodrębnić paletę kolorów wszystkich dominujących odcieni obecnych na dostarczonym obrazie.

Proszę dodać słowo „Poufne” jako znak wodny w lewym górnym rogu załączonego obrazu, aby zapewnić dyskrecję i profesjonalizm przy jednoczesnym zachowaniu jego widoczności w celu zachowania poufności.

Przetwórz towarzyszącą treść wizualną, aby zidentyfikować rysy twarzy, a następnie nałóż na te obrazy półprzezroczysty krzyżyk.

Odwróć schemat kolorów ostatniej ćwiartki w obrazie podzielonym na cztery sekcje, po wstępnym podzieleniu go na cztery równe części.

Powiększ załączony obraz, pozwalając na bliższe przyjrzenie się jego szczegółom, a następnie stopniowo oddalaj, aby zapewnić widzowi kontekst.

„Proszę stworzyć animację GIF, łącząc dostarczone pliki graficzne z dodatkowym efektem pomniejszenia.

Wykonaj rozpoznawanie twarzy na zdjęciu, jeśli ma to zastosowanie, i zasłoń wszelkie dostrzegalne twarze ze względu na kwestie związane z prywatnością.

W przykładowym scenariuszu przedstawionym poniżej poinstruowaliśmy ChatGPT, aby podzielił obraz na cztery równe sektory i zmienił odcienie końcowego segmentu.

/pl/images/split-image-into-quadrants.jpg

W kolejnym przypadku przesłaliśmy przedstawienie graficzne i poprosiliśmy ChatGTP o zasłonięcie wizerunku w ramach wspomnianej reprezentacji wizualnej.

/pl/images/blurring-a-face-using-chatgpt-code-interpreter.jpg

Oprócz tych technik manipulacji możliwe jest również wyodrębnienie odpowiednich metadanych z obrazu. Masz możliwość określenia dokładnych metadanych, które chcesz wyodrębnić, lub alternatywnie zażądania, aby ChatGPT wyodrębnił wszystkie istotne informacje z towarzyszącego obrazu. Ponadto wtyczka umożliwia tworzenie obrazów od podstaw.

Korzystając z dostarczonego interpretera kodu, wygenerowaliśmy wizualną reprezentację imion dwudziestu ostatnich prezydentów Stanów Zjednoczonych. Chociaż ten przypadek może nie być uważany za przykładowy, służy on jako praktyczna ilustracja możliwości dostępnych w naszym systemie.

/pl/images/word-cloud-created-with-chatgpt-code-interpreter.jpg

Z pewnością możesz poprosić o modyfikacje, takie jak zmiana odcienia tła lub zastosowanie odrębnego kroju pisma w treści wizualnej za pomocą wtyczki Code Interpreter. Za pomocą tego narzędzia można wykonać wiele kreatywnych technik na obrazach cyfrowych. Jeśli brakuje Ci inspiracji, po prostu prześlij grafikę i zapytaj ChatGPT o różne operacje, które można na niej wykonać.

Twórz i edytuj filmy

W podobny sposób jak interpreter kodu ChatGPT działa w odniesieniu do przetwarzania obrazu, jest również w stanie wykonywać różne operacje na danych wideo. Możliwości te obejmują wyodrębnianie metadanych z plików wideo oraz możliwość przechwytywania klatek w określonych znacznikach czasu. Ponadto możliwe są również bardziej złożone działania, takie jak regulacja jasności i kontrastu, przycinanie i łączenie wielu klipów.

⭐Konwertuj filmy na GIF.

Skonstruuj prezentację audiowizualną, integrując wiele elementów graficznych i dołączając towarzyszący dźwięk.

Przetwarzaj pliki wideo, dzieląc je na segmenty spełniające określone kryteria.

⭐Wyodrębnij dźwięk z pliku wideo

⭐Wyodrębnij napisy z filmu

⭐Kompresuj wideo

Konwertuj plik wideo z jego oryginalnego formatu na inny format, na przykład zmieniając plik AVI na plik MP4 w celu łatwiejszego odtwarzania na różnych urządzeniach lub lepszego wykorzystania przestrzeni dyskowej.

Z pewnością oto elegancki opis różnych operacji, które można wykonać na wideo przy użyciu interpretera kodowania ChatGPT:

/pl/images/things-you-can-do-with-a-video-using-chatgpt-code-interpreter.jpg

Korzystając z ChatGPT, z powodzeniem wyodrębniliśmy zawartość audio ze skromnego pliku wideo w ciągu zaledwie kilku sekund. Uzyskany następnie plik audio, gotowy do pobrania, wykazywał wyjątkową klarowność i wierność.

/pl/images/extracting-audio-from-a-video-file.jpg

Funkcjonalność wtyczki Code Interpreter jest wszechstronna pod względem możliwości manipulowania treścią wideo; jednak obecne wykorzystanie jest nieco ograniczone ze względu na ograniczenia dotyczące rozmiarów plików, które może pomieścić. Zdolność Code Interpreter do przetwarzania dużych plików wideo nie została jeszcze definitywnie ustalona, ​​a wydajność może ulec pogorszeniu w przypadku obsługi bardziej ekspansywnych multimediów. Aby zoptymalizować wyniki, rozsądnie byłoby pracować z mniejszymi plikami wideo i minimalizować jakość obrazu w razie potrzeby.

Twórz i modyfikuj pliki audio

Code Interpreter ChatGPT oferuje zintegrowaną funkcję zamiany tekstu na mowę, umożliwiającą użytkownikom łatwe generowanie plików audio z treści pisanych. Dodatkowo wtyczka Code Interpreter oferuje szereg urzekających możliwości manipulowania plikami audio, w tym:

Konwersja plików audio z jednego formatu pliku na inny jest częstym zadaniem, takim jak konwersja plików WAV do formatu MP3. Proces ten pozwala na większą wygodę udostępniania i przechowywania cyfrowych plików multimedialnych przy zachowaniu wysokiej jakości dźwięku.

Odczytywanie i edytowanie metadanych lub znaczników powiązanych z plikiem audio wiąże się z uzyskiwaniem dostępu do takich informacji, jak tytuł, wykonawca i nazwa albumu oraz manipulowanie nimi. Proces ten można przeprowadzić za pomocą różnych aplikacji lub narzędzi do zarządzania muzyką, które umożliwiają użytkownikom przeglądanie i modyfikowanie tych danych w celu poprawy organizacji i dostępności ich kolekcji multimediów cyfrowych.

Jednym z możliwych sposobów zmiany tonacji lub zakresu tonacji nagrania audio jest użycie narzędzi programowych zaprojektowanych specjalnie do tego celu, takich jak wtyczka zmiany tonacji dla aplikacji cyfrowej stacji roboczej audio (DAW), takich jak Pro Tools, Logic Pro, Ableton Live lub Adobe Audition. Wtyczki te umożliwiają użytkownikom dostosowanie tonu określonych częstotliwości w ścieżce audio poprzez zmianę prędkości odtwarzania nagranej fali dźwiękowej, co skutkuje wyższym lub niższym tonem w porównaniu z pierwotnym stanem. Ponadto niektóre programy mogą oferować inne funkcje, takie jak rozciąganie czasu i opcje dostrajania, co pozwala na większą kontrolę nad końcowym wynikiem.

⭐Połącz ze sobą dwa pliki audio

Zmodyfikuj częstotliwość próbkowania, szybkość przesyłania danych lub liczbę kanałów audio obecnych w danym cyfrowym pliku audio.

Aby skrócić lub edytować plik audio, zaznaczając i usuwając jego fragmenty, które wykraczają poza określony czas trwania, w celu utworzenia krótszej wersji zawierającej tylko żądaną zawartość w określonym przedziale czasowym.

Proces nakładania jednego nagrania audio na inne jest znany jako nakładanie lub nakładanie pliku audio na inny plik audio. Można to zrobić za pomocą różnych programów, które pozwalają na edycję i manipulację nagraniami audio, takich jak Adobe Audition lub Pro Tools. Wynikowy plik dźwiękowy będzie zawierał zarówno oryginalne nagranie dźwiękowe, jak i nałożone nagranie dźwiękowe, co może tworzyć unikalne efekty i poprawiać ogólne wrażenia słuchowe.

Czytaj, edytuj i twórz dokumenty

Niezaprzeczalnie obsługa plików jest niezwykłą siłą Interpretera kodu. Jego zakres możliwości znacznie wykracza poza zwykłe przetwarzanie mediów wizualnych, takich jak obrazy, audio i wideo.

Ta wszechstronna wtyczka ma możliwość przetwarzania szerokiego zakresu typów dokumentów do celów czytania, generowania i edycji. Obejmuje popularne formaty, takie jak pliki PDF, dokumenty Microsoft Word, zwykłe pliki tekstowe, Rich Text Format (RTF), liczne formaty arkuszy kalkulacyjnych oraz pliki języków programowania, takie jak Python (.py) i JavaScript (.js). Obecny zakres obsługiwanych formatów plików przez interpreter kodu wynosi około sto czterdzieści sześć.

Ostateczny cel zależy od pożądanego wyniku. Można zdecydować się na dołączenie dokumentu PDF do swojego zapytania, a następnie skierować ChatGPT do zapoznania się z jego treścią, zinterpretowania języka i wygenerowania dokumentu Microsoft Word zawierającego przetłumaczony tekst.

Alternatywnie możesz zaimportować informacje przechowywane w dokumencie Microsoft Word i selektywnie pobrać dane, które są zgodne z określonym zestawem kryteriów, co skutkuje wygenerowaniem pliku arkusza kalkulacyjnego. Ponadto możliwe jest generowanie reprezentacji graficznych, takich jak wykresy słupkowe i wykresy liniowe, wykorzystując moc dokumentów.

Weź pod uwagę wszelkie nieprzewidziane zdarzenia, które mogą wystąpić podczas praktycznego zastosowania, w szczególności te związane z generowaniem lub przeglądaniem różnych typów dokumentów. W takich okolicznościach wtyczka Code Interpreter prawdopodobnie będzie wykazywać się wszechstronnością i zdolnością adaptacji do ich obsługi.

Pisz i analizuj kod

Wykorzystanie Code Interpreter prezentuje się jako optymalne rozwiązanie do odszyfrowywania znacznych dokumentów kodowanych. Załączając obszerne pliki źródłowe zawierające tysiące linii kodu, można zażądać od interpretera kodu pełnego zrozumienia jego funkcjonalności, a następnie ewentualnych wysiłków związanych z debugowaniem, inicjatywami restrukturyzacyjnymi, a nawet tłumaczeniem wspomnianego kodu na alternatywne języki programowania-wszystko w dążeniu do realizując różnorodne przedsięwzięcia programistyczne.

Rzeczywiście, chociaż zarówno Code Interpreter, jak i zwykły ChatGPT mają tę samą podstawową architekturę, podejście Code Interpreter do obsługi zapytań związanych z kodem wydaje się być wzmocnione przez jego zdolność do utrzymywania szerszego zakresu informacji kontekstowych. Ta pojemność pozwala na przetwarzanie większej ilości danych w ramach jednej interakcji, dzięki czemu jest potencjalnie bardziej wydajna niż jej niekodowy odpowiednik w rozwiązywaniu problemów programistycznych.

Ta zaleta jest szczególnie godna uwagi w przypadkach takich jak programowanie, w którym pliki kodu mogą obejmować znaczną liczbę znaków rozciągających się na kilka tysięcy wierszy.

Aby ocenić jego zdolność do zarządzania obszernymi repozytoriami kodu źródłowego, zakupiliśmy kompleksowe rozwiązanie do uwierzytelniania użytkowników od GitHub, zapisaliśmy je w postaci spakowanego archiwum i poprosiliśmy Code Interpreter o przedstawienie ogólnego celu projektu. Platforma wykazała się niezwykłą biegłością, wyodrębniając zawartość pliku, przeglądając każdy katalog i dostarczając szczegółowego opisu celów projektu.

Wtyczka wykazała imponującą zdolność wykrywania i modyfikowania odpowiednich plików w odpowiedzi na naszą prośbę o dodatkowe funkcje. Był w stanie samodzielnie wykonywać te czynności, nie wymagając żadnej interwencji z naszej strony.

Niezaprzeczalnie po ocenie projekt wykazał bezproblemową funkcjonalność po integracji proponowanego rozszerzenia. Chociaż podczas poruszania się po obszernych bazach kodu można napotkać sporadyczne przeszkody, funkcja Code Interpreter bezsprzecznie oferuje nieocenioną przewagę w tym zakresie.

Wyodrębnij tekst z obrazów (optyczne rozpoznawanie znaków)

Wykorzystując zaawansowane możliwości naszego interpretera kodu, jesteśmy w stanie bez wysiłku przetwarzać obrazy zawierające tekst dla Twojej wygody. Aby wykonać to zadanie, po prostu prześlij nam obraz, którego dotyczy problem, i poproś o wyodrębnienie jego zawartości za pośrednictwem ChatGPT. Nasze rozwiązanie jest bardzo skuteczne w przypadku zrzutów ekranu, zdjęć dokumentów, obrazów z nałożonym tekstem i wielu innych formatów.

Oprogramowanie jest w stanie przetwarzać różne formy wprowadzania tekstu, w tym te, które są zasłonięte, nieostre lub prezentowane za pomocą różnych typów czcionek, rozmiarów, stylów, pozycji i schematów kolorów. Na przykład można poinstruować ChatGPT, aby wygenerował plik Microsoft Word z cyfrowego skanu przesłanego przez siebie dokumentu i otrzymał gotowy produkt w ciągu zaledwie kilku sekund.

Potężne narzędzie na wyciągnięcie ręki

Należy zauważyć, że obecne funkcje wtyczki Code Interpreter są ograniczone pod różnymi względami; jednak ta wtyczka pozostaje godną uwagi funkcją wśród internetowych chatbotów AI ze względu na jej ogromny potencjał.

Oczekuje się, że komponent Code Interpreter, zwiększając swoją zdolność do obsługi większych zestawów danych w swojej pamięci, odróżni ChatGPT od swoich rówieśników w tej dziedzinie. Ponadto istnieją dalsze możliwości, które można zbadać za pomocą ChatGPT poza tym, co zostało już osiągnięte.